On Thursday, July 4, 2024 9:56 AM, Abraham Zsombor Nagy wrote:
>I'm trying to push my code to GitHub, however I'm unable to do so:
>
>abris@dell:~/Projects/maradandohalo/server$ git push --set-upstream origin main
>Username for 'https://github.com': nazsombor Password for
>'https://nazsombor@github.com':
>fatal: protocol error: bad line length 175
>send-pack: unexpected disconnect while reading sideband packet
>error: failed to push some refs to
>'https://github.com/nazsombor/maradandohalo.git'
>Enumerating objects: 31, done.
>Counting objects: 100% (31/31), done.
>Delta compression using up to 16 threads Compressing objects: 100% (22/22),
>done.
>
>I use Debian 12. I tried this with the git installed via apt as well with the git compiled
>from source code. Git version: 2.45.GIT
>
>I also asked this question first on StackOverflow:
>https://stackoverflow.com/questions/78670914/git-fatal-protocol-error-bad-line-
>length-173
As far as I know, GitHub changed to use personal access tokens to authentication for HTTPS push rather than password. Have you tried SSH?
--Randall
